Produktbeschreibung
Topophilia and Topophobia relates our love of a place and aversion to it to the human habitats of the twentieth century, presenting a comprehensive range of case studies and philosophical musings dealing with cities and architecture.

Autorenporträt
Xing Ruan is Professor of Architecture at the University of New South Wales and is the author of Allegorical Architecture (2006) and New China Architecture (2006). He has published on a wide range of topics concerning legible relations between humans and the built world in some of the world's leading scholarly journals, as well as professional magazines in China and Australia. Paul Hogben is a lecturer in architecture at the University of New South Wales. His research focuses on promotional politics and the discourse of architecture over the twentieth century. This research has been published in Architectural Theory Review and Fabrications, the journal of the Society of Architectural Historians, Australia and New Zealand.
